While I actually prefer Johan's method of adding the User Confirm MGMT code,
with it's code re-use between user_confirm_reply, and user_confirm_neg_reply,
I have broken the user_passkey_reply out from user_passkey_neg_reply, and
added an additional patch to hook in the HCI/SSP based usage of passkeys.

This makes sense, I suppose, since the regular and neg replies for passkeys
are different sizes.

Passkey's only come into play only if our OI_CAP happens to be
KeyboardOnly (for BR/EDR/LER) or DisplayKeyboard (LE only).

So the summary of the changes is:

1. Addition of BR/EDR vs LE breakout in user_confirm_reply
	1.1 Adds SMP placeholder
	1.2 Keeps Johan's confirm_reply & confirm_neg_reply structure.
		1.2.1 Johan can defend or change that himself, but the existing code works.

2. Addition of user_passkey_reply, with both BR/EDR (SSP) and LE (SMP) handling
	2.1 Adds approriate SSP HCI opcodes
	2.2 Adds appropriate MGMT opcodes
	2.3 Adds SMP placeholder
	2.4 Seperate paths for passkey_reply & passkey_neg_reply

3. Addition of HCI event handling and forwarding for the appropriate BR/EDR SSP events

* [PATCH 1/3] Bluetooth: Add SMP support to user_confirm_reply

to enable User Confirmation during LE-SMP pairing.

Signed-off-by: Brian Gix <bgix@codeaurora.org>
---
 net/bluetooth/mgmt.c |   22 +++++++++++++++++++---
 1 files changed, 19 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c b/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
index a6720c6..761d607 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
@@ -1423,6 +1423,7 @@ static int user_confirm_reply(struct sock *sk, u16 index, unsigned char *data,
 	u16 mgmt_op, hci_op;
 	struct pending_cmd *cmd;
 	struct hci_dev *hdev;
+	struct hci_conn *conn;
 	int err;
 
 	BT_DBG("");
@@ -1446,20 +1447,35 @@ static int user_confirm_reply(struct sock *sk, u16 index, unsigned char *data,
 
 	if (!test_bit(HCI_UP, &hdev->flags)) {
 		err = cmd_status(sk, index, mgmt_op, ENETDOWN);
-		goto failed;
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	/* Route command to HCI (if ACL Link) or SMP (if LE Link) */
+	conn = hci_conn_hash_lookup_ba(hdev, ACL_LINK, &cp->bdaddr);
+	if (!conn) {
+		conn = hci_conn_hash_lookup_ba(hdev, LE_LINK, &cp->bdaddr);
+		if (!conn) {
+			err = cmd_status(sk, index, mgmt_op, ENOTCONN);
+			goto done;
+		}
+
+		/* Forward Confirm response to SMP */
+
+		err = cmd_status(sk, index, mgmt_op, 0);
+		goto done;
 	}
 
 	cmd = mgmt_pending_add(sk, mgmt_op, hdev, data, len);
 	if (!cmd) {
 		err = -ENOMEM;
-		goto failed;
+		goto done;
 	}
 
 	err = hci_send_cmd(hdev, hci_op, sizeof(cp->bdaddr), &cp->bdaddr);
 	if (err < 0)
 		mgmt_pending_remove(cmd);
 
-failed:
+done:
 	hci_dev_unlock_bh(hdev);
 	hci_dev_put(hdev);

* [PATCH 2/3] Bluetooth: Add MGMT opcode for User Passkey entry

 include/net/bluetooth/hci.h  |    8 +++
 include/net/bluetooth/mgmt.h |   11 +++
 net/bluetooth/mgmt.c         |  143 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 3 files changed, 162 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)

diff --git a/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h b/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h
index 139ce2a..ac107b5 100644
--- a/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h
+++ b/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h
@@ -453,6 +453,14 @@ struct hci_rp_user_confirm_reply {
 
 #define HCI_OP_USER_CONFIRM_NEG_REPLY	0x042d
 
+#define HCI_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Y		0x042e
+struct hci_cp_user_passkey_reply {
+	bdaddr_t bdaddr;
+	__u32	passkey;
+} __packed;
+
+#define HCI_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Y	0x042f
+
 #define HCI_OP_REMOTE_OOB_DATA_REPLY	0x0430
 struct hci_cp_remote_oob_data_reply {
 	bdaddr_t bdaddr;
diff --git a/include/net/bluetooth/mgmt.h b/include/net/bluetooth/mgmt.h
index 3e320c9..d67683f 100644
--- a/include/net/bluetooth/mgmt.h
+++ b/include/net/bluetooth/mgmt.h
@@ -228,6 +228,17 @@ struct mgmt_cp_set_fast_connectable {
 	__u8 enable;
 } __packed;
 
+#define M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Y	0x0020
+struct mgmt_cp_user_passkey_reply {
+	bdaddr_t bdaddr;
+	__le32 passkey;
+} __packed;
+
+#define M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Y	0x0021
+struct mgmt_cp_user_passkey_neg_reply {
+	bdaddr_t bdaddr;
+} __packed;
+
 #define MGMT_EV_CMD_COMPLETE		0x0001
 struct mgmt_ev_cmd_complete {
 	__le16 opcode;
diff --git a/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c b/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
index 761d607..d5116c2 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/mgmt.c
@@ -1482,6 +1482,128 @@ done:
 	return err;
 }
 
+static int user_passkey_reply(struct sock *sk, u16 index, unsigned char *data,
+									u16 len)
+{
+	struct mgmt_cp_user_passkey_reply *cp = (void *) data;
+	struct pending_cmd *cmd;
+	struct hci_dev *hdev;
+	struct hci_conn *conn;
+	int err = 0;
+
+	BT_DBG("");
+
+	if (len != sizeof(*cp))
+		return c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Y,
+									EINVAL);
+
+	hdev = hci_dev_get(index);
+	if (!hdev)
+		return c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Y,
+									ENODEV);
+
+	hci_dev_lock_bh(hdev);
+
+	if (!test_bit(HCI_UP, &hdev->flags)) {
+		err = c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Y,
+								ENETDOWN);
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	/* Route command to HCI (if ACL Link) or SMP (if LE Link) */
+	conn = hci_conn_hash_lookup_ba(hdev, ACL_LINK, &cp->bdaddr);
+	if (!conn) {
+		conn = hci_conn_hash_lookup_ba(hdev, LE_LINK, &cp->bdaddr);
+		if (!conn) {
+			err = c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Y,
+								ENOTCONN);
+			goto done;
+		}
+
+		/* Forward Passkey response to SMP */
+
+		err = c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Y, 0);
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	cmd = mgmt_pending_add(sk,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Y, hdev, data, len);
+	if (!cmd) {
+		err = -ENOMEM;
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	err = hci_send_cmd(hdev, HCI_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Y, len, cp);
+	if (err < 0)
+		mgmt_pending_remove(cmd);
+
+done:
+	hci_dev_unlock_bh(hdev);
+	hci_dev_put(hdev);
+
+	return err;
+}
+
+static int user_passkey_neg_reply(struct sock *sk, u16 index,
+						unsigned char *data, u16 len)
+{
+	struct mgmt_cp_user_passkey_neg_reply *cp = (void *) data;
+	struct pending_cmd *cmd;
+	struct hci_dev *hdev;
+	struct hci_conn *conn;
+	int err = 0;
+
+	BT_DBG("");
+
+	if (len != sizeof(*cp))
+		return c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Y,
+									EINVAL);
+
+	hdev = hci_dev_get(index);
+	if (!hdev)
+		return c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Y,
+									ENODEV);
+
+	hci_dev_lock_bh(hdev);
+
+	if (!test_bit(HCI_UP, &hdev->flags)) {
+		err = c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Y,
+								ENETDOWN);
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	conn = hci_conn_hash_lookup_ba(hdev, ACL_LINK, &cp->bdaddr);
+	if (!conn) {
+		conn = hci_conn_hash_lookup_ba(hdev, LE_LINK, &cp->bdaddr);
+		if (!conn) {
+			err = cmd_status(sk, index,
+					M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Y,
+					ENOTCONN);
+			goto done;
+		}
+
+		/* Forward Passkey response to SMP */
+
+		err = cmd_status(sk, index,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Y, 0);
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	cmd = mgmt_pending_add(sk, M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Y, hdev, data,
+									len);
+	if (!cmd) {
+		err = -ENOMEM;
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	err = hci_send_cmd(hdev, HCI_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Y, len, cp);
+	if (err < 0)
+		mgmt_pending_remove(cmd);
+
+done:
+	hci_dev_unlock_bh(hdev);
+	hci_dev_put(hdev);
+
+	return err;
+}
 static int set_local_name(struct sock *sk, u16 index, unsigned char *data,
 								u16 len)
 {
@@ -1923,6 +2045,13 @@ int mgmt_control(struct sock *sk, struct msghdr *msg, size_t msglen)
 	case MGMT_OP_USER_CONFIRM_NEG_REPLY:
 		err = user_confirm_reply(sk, index, buf + sizeof(*hdr), len, 0);
 		break;
+	case M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Y:
+		err = user_passkey_reply(sk, index, buf + sizeof(*hdr), len);
+		break;
+	case M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Y:
+		err = user_passkey_neg_reply(sk, index, buf + sizeof(*hdr),
+									len);
+		break;
 	case MGMT_OP_SET_LOCAL_NAME:
 		err = set_local_name(sk, index, buf + sizeof(*hdr), len);
 		break;
@@ -2281,6 +2410,20 @@ int mgmt_user_confirm_neg_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ev,
 					MGMT_OP_USER_CONFIRM_NEG_REPLY);
 }
 
+int mgmt_user_passkey_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ev, bdaddr_t *bdaddr,
+								u8 status)
+{
+	return confirm_reply_complete(hdev, bdaddr, status,
+						M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Y);
+}
+
+int mgmt_user_passkey_neg_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ev,
+						bdaddr_t *bdaddr, u8 status)
+{
+	return confirm_reply_complete(hdev, bdaddr, status,
+					MGMT_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Y);
+}
+
 int mgmt_auth_failed(struct hci_dev *hdev, bdaddr_t *bdaddr, u8 status)
 {
 	struct mgmt_ev_auth_failed ev;

* [PATCH 3/3] Bluetooth: Add User Passkey entry to HCI Events

 include/net/bluetooth/hci.h      |    5 +++
 include/net/bluetooth/hci_core.h |    4 ++
 net/bluetooth/hci_event.c        |   62 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 3 files changed, 71 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)

diff --git a/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h b/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h
index ac107b5..d1af139 100644
--- a/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h
+++ b/include/net/bluetooth/hci.h
@@ -1084,6 +1084,11 @@ struct hci_ev_user_confirm_req {
 	__le32		passkey;
 } __packed;
 
+#define HCI_EV_USER_PASSKEY_REQUEST	0x34
+struct hci_ev_user_passkey_req {
+	bdaddr_t	bdaddr;
+} __packed;
+
 #define HCI_EV_REMOTE_OOB_DATA_REQUEST	0x35
 struct hci_ev_remote_oob_data_request {
 	bdaddr_t bdaddr;
diff --git a/include/net/bluetooth/hci_core.h b/include/net/bluetooth/hci_core.h
index 0a5a05d..943f4fc 100644
--- a/include/net/bluetooth/hci_core.h
+++ b/include/net/bluetooth/hci_core.h
@@ -931,6 +931,10 @@ int mgmt_user_confirm_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ev, bdaddr_t *bdaddr,
 								u8 status);
 int mgmt_user_confirm_neg_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ev,
 						bdaddr_t *bdaddr, u8 status);
+int mgmt_user_passkey_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ev, bdaddr_t *bdaddr,
+								u8 status);
+int mgmt_user_passkey_neg_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ev,
+						bdaddr_t *bdaddr, u8 status);
 int mgmt_auth_failed(struct hci_dev *hdev, bdaddr_t *bdaddr, u8 status);
 int mgmt_set_local_name_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ev, u8 *name, u8 status);
 int mgmt_read_local_oob_data_reply_complete(struct hci_dev *hdev, u8 *hash,
diff --git a/net/bluetooth/hci_event.c b/net/bluetooth/hci_event.c
index a89cf1f..3006058 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/hci_event.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/hci_event.c
@@ -927,6 +927,37 @@ static void hci_cc_user_confirm_neg_reply(struct hci_dev *hdev,
 	hci_dev_unlock(hdev);
 }
 
+static void hci_cc_user_passkey_reply(struct hci_dev *hdev, struct sk_buff *skb)
+{
+	struct hci_rp_user_confirm_reply *rp = (void *) skb->data;
+
+	BT_DBG("%s status 0x%x", hdev->name, rp->status);
+
+	hci_dev_lock(hdev);
+
+	if (test_bit(HCI_MGMT, &hdev->flags))
+		mgmt_user_passkey_reply_complete(hdev, &rp->bdaddr,
+								rp->status);
+
+	hci_dev_unlock(hdev);
+}
+
+static void hci_cc_user_passkey_neg_reply(struct hci_dev *hdev,
+							struct sk_buff *skb)
+{
+	struct hci_rp_user_confirm_reply *rp = (void *) skb->data;
+
+	BT_DBG("%s status 0x%x", hdev->name, rp->status);
+
+	hci_dev_lock(hdev);
+
+	if (test_bit(HCI_MGMT, &hdev->flags))
+		mgmt_user_passkey_neg_reply_complete(hdev, &rp->bdaddr,
+								rp->status);
+
+	hci_dev_unlock(hdev);
+}
+
 static void hci_cc_read_local_oob_data_reply(struct hci_dev *hdev,
 							struct sk_buff *skb)
 {
@@ -2009,6 +2040,14 @@ static inline void hci_cmd_complete_evt(struct hci_dev *hdev, struct sk_buff *sk
 		hci_cc_user_confirm_neg_reply(hdev, skb);
 		break;
 
+	case HCI_OP_USER_PASSKEY_REPLY:
+		hci_cc_user_passkey_reply(hdev, skb);
+		break;
+
+	case HCI_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Y:
+		hci_cc_user_passkey_neg_reply(hdev, skb);
+		break;
+
 	case HCI_OP_LE_SET_SCAN_ENABLE:
 		hci_cc_le_set_scan_enable(hdev, skb);
 		break;
@@ -2768,6 +2807,25 @@ unlock:
 	hci_dev_unlock(hdev);
 }
 
+static inline void hci_user_passkey_request_evt(struct hci_dev *hdev,
+							struct sk_buff *skb)
+{
+	struct hci_ev_user_passkey_req *ev = (void *) skb->data;
+
+	BT_DBG("%s", hdev->name);
+
+	hci_dev_lock(hdev);
+
+	/* Passkey Request is a degenerate case of User Confirm */
+	if (test_bit(HCI_MGMT, &hdev->flags))
+		mgmt_user_confirm_request(hdev, &ev->bdaddr, 0, 0);
+	else
+		hci_send_cmd(hdev, HCI_OP_USER_PASSKEY_NEG_REPLY,
+					sizeof(ev->bdaddr), &ev->bdaddr);
+
+	hci_dev_unlock(hdev);
+}
+
 static inline void hci_simple_pair_complete_evt(struct hci_dev *hdev, struct sk_buff *skb)
 {
 	struct hci_ev_simple_pair_complete *ev = (void *) skb->data;
@@ -3106,6 +3164,10 @@ void hci_event_packet(struct hci_dev *hdev, struct sk_buff *skb)
 		hci_user_confirm_request_evt(hdev, skb);
 		break;
 
+	case HCI_EV_USER_PASSKEY_REQUEST:
+		hci_user_passkey_request_evt(hdev, skb);
+		break;
+
 	case HCI_EV_SIMPLE_PAIR_COMPLETE:
 		hci_simple_pair_complete_evt(hdev, skb);
 		break;
